Transaction 15023d58302730444656d8c4d5b23c01e0717ed2a38d10533b33bd0382efd4f3
1 Input
1 Output
-
15023d58302730444656d8c4d5b23c01e0717ed2a38d10533b33bd0382efd4f3:0
- value
- 3567670
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d91a362f81874732d9978d573dcd9cea5a16de59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lnw2r32r1X8uKpSpoWnRgaeKziP4vrdrB